32606 ZIP Code — Gainesville, FL
Alachua County, Florida
ZIP code 32606 is located in
Gainesville ,
Florida ,
within Alachua County .
It covers approximately 15.39 square miles and serves a population of
23,317 residents.
This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one,
served by area code 352 .
About ZIP code 32606
The housing stock consists of a mix of housing types. Most homes were built in the 1990s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$294,900. Owner-occupancy sits near the national average at 47%.
The gap between median ($77,733) and mean household income suggests income inequality — a small number of higher earners pull the average up. 38%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.
The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 20 minutes is near the national average.
Educational attainment is high — 59%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national average of 33%.
Overall, ZIP code 32606 reflects a community defined by a highly educated population and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
